Output d01d9fd295981a7c2a608da175f6fbc660e98fcb29b32a05ab530e350fabfe4f:3

value
1621797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ba7a53c38af4b57025660a2710cc6454e980178a OP_EQUAL
address
3Jh29fesTzpSPLwk6QHaCdbisYbL4mGC5R
transaction
d01d9fd295981a7c2a608da175f6fbc660e98fcb29b32a05ab530e350fabfe4f
confirmations
18163
spent
true